Slope Weed Control Questions
What is slope weed control? Slope weed control involves managing and removing weeds on inclined surfaces to prevent erosion and maintain landscape appearance.
What types of weeds are targeted? The service typically focuses on invasive grasses, broadleaf weeds, and unwanted vegetation that thrive on slopes.
Why is weed control important on slopes? Proper weed control helps prevent soil erosion, promotes healthy plant growth, and enhances the overall look of the property.
How is weed control applied on slopes? Treatments often include manual removal, herbicide application, and erosion control methods tailored to slope conditions.
